When Uli Hoeneß speaks about Bayern Munich players, supporters tend to listen. The club’s honorary president has seen countless world-class talents wear the famous red shirt, so comparisons to club legends are never made lightly.
That is why his recent praise of Michael Olise carries so much weight.
“His incredible technique, his work rate, and above all, his finishing precision are exceptional. Arjen Robben was similar in this respect, but I think Michael has even more precision with his irresistible left-footed shot into the top left corner. He’s simply too technically gifted. He always gets the timing right, waits until the opponent is out of position or has shifted his weight incorrectly – and then he’s gone. He hardly needs any time to look for the shot. That’s unusual,” Hoeneß told DAZN (as captured by @iMiaSanMia ).
Mentioning Arjen Robben in the same breath as any winger is a massive compliment. The Dutch legend built a Hall of Fame-worthy career by cutting inside from the right and unleashing a left-footed strike that defenders knew was coming but still could not stop. Hoeneß believes Olise possesses many of those same qualities, while suggesting his finishing may be even more precise.
What makes Olise so dangerous is not just his technical ability, but his decision-making. As Hoeneß points out, the French international rarely forces the action. Instead, he patiently waits for a defender to lose balance or shift weight before accelerating into space. Those split-second reads often make the difference between a blocked effort and a goal.
Olise has already established himself as one of Bayern Munich’s most important attacking weapons, and his ceiling still appears incredibly high. If he continues developing at this pace, comparisons to Robben may eventually feel less like lofty praise and more like an accurate reflection of his place among the club’s elite wingers.
For Bayern Munich supporters, that is an exciting possibility.
